I've been thinking about this. Why not work backwards - a safe place to finish would be the back road in Bishopthorpe, so let's try and finish there.

How about this?

Meet in the same place then

Rufforth -> towards Askham Richard -> Healaugh -> Wighill -> back lanes to Tadcaster, then back on the other side of the A64, Bolton Percy -> Applelton Roebuck -> B'thorpe.

Sprint for somewhere before the final bend into B'thorpe.

That'd be fine for this week. Then for later in the year you could add a loop based at Tadcaster e.g. Tad -> Grammer School -> Braham -> old A1 -> back into Braham, up the hill by the Church and retrace.

You could even go up to Thorner for the extra miles in high summer when we're all raring to go. It's hilly there mind.
